The Somerset Academy South Homestead Hurricanes are taking a road trip to square off against the Varela Vipers at 3:30 p.m. on Thursday. Somerset Academy South Homestead has given up an average of 11.1 runs per game this season, but Thursday's game will give them a chance to turn things around.
Somerset Academy South Homestead blew Coral Shores out of the water the last time the pair played, but on Tuesday Coral Shores got their revenge. Somerset Academy South Homestead fell just short of Coral Shores by a score of 27-25. On the bright side, the 25- run effort marked Somerset Academy South Homestead's highest-scoring game to date.

Somerset Academy South Homestead got a massive performance out of Mia Santiago, who scored two runs and stole three bases while getting on base in four of her six plate appearances. Santiago has been hot recently, having posted at least one stolen base the last four times she's played. Olivia Fleitas was another key player, scoring four runs and stealing five bases while getting on base in five of her seven plate appearances.
Meanwhile, Varela made easy work of iMater Charter on Tuesday and carried off an 18-3 win. The result was nothing new for the Vipers, who have now won five contests by 11 runs or more so far this season.
The victory made it two in a row for Varela and bumps their season record up to 5-6. The wins came thanks in part to their pitching effort, having only surrendered a grand total of 6 runs in those games. As for Somerset Academy South Homestead, they are on a three-game losing streak that has dropped them down to 7-5.
Somerset Academy South Homestead might still be hurting after the 16-4 loss they got from Varela in their previous meeting back in March of 2024. Can the Hurricanes avenge their defeat or is history doomed to repeat itself? We'll find out soon enough.
